diff --git a/.perm_test_apache b/.perm_test_apache new file mode 100644 index 0000000..e69de29 diff --git a/.perm_test_exec b/.perm_test_exec new file mode 100644 index 0000000..e69de29 diff --git a/db/config.php b/db/config.php new file mode 100644 index 0000000..c9de740 --- /dev/null +++ b/db/config.php @@ -0,0 +1,17 @@ + PDO::ERRMODE_EXCEPTION, + PDO::ATTR_DEFAULT_FETCH_MODE => PDO::FETCH_ASSOC, + ]); + } + return $pdo; +} diff --git a/db/schema.sql b/db/schema.sql new file mode 100644 index 0000000..0df05be --- /dev/null +++ b/db/schema.sql @@ -0,0 +1,35 @@ +-- Database schema for Iron and Vines application +-- Target database: app_39285 + +CREATE TABLE IF NOT EXISTS members ( + id VARCHAR(36) PRIMARY KEY, + name VARCHAR(255) NOT NULL, + city VARCHAR(255), + moto VARCHAR(255), + photo VARCHAR(255), + created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P +); + +CREATE TABLE IF NOT EXISTS sponsors ( + id VARCHAR(36) PRIMARY KEY, + name VARCHAR(255) NOT NULL, + logo VARCHAR(255), + link VARCHAR(255), + created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P +); + +CREATE TABLE IF NOT EXISTS gallery ( + id VARCHAR(36) PRIMARY KEY, + url VARCHAR(255) NOT NULL, + description TEXT, + created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P +); + +CREATE TABLE IF NOT EXISTS events ( + id VARCHAR(36) PRIMARY KEY, + title VARCHAR(255) NOT NULL, + date DATE NOT NULL, + location VARCHAR(255), + description TEXT, + created_at TIMESTAMP DEFAULT CURRENT_TIMESTAMP +); diff --git a/iron-and-vines-main/package-lock.json b/iron-and-vines-main/package-lock.json index d76fb5e..dc2ed2a 100644 --- a/iron-and-vines-main/package-lock.json +++ b/iron-and-vines-main/package-lock.json @@ -2962,9 +2962,6 @@ "arm" ], "dev": true, - "libc": [ - "glibc" - ], "license": "MIT", "optional": true, "os": [ @@ -2979,9 +2976,6 @@ "arm" ], "dev": true, - "libc": [ - "musl" - ], "license": "MIT", "optional": true, "os": [ @@ -2996,9 +2990,6 @@ "arm64" ], "dev": true, - "libc": [ - "glibc" - ], "license": "MIT", "optional": true, "os": [ @@ -3013,9 +3004,6 @@ "arm64" ], "dev": true, - "libc": [ - "musl" - ], "license": "MIT", "optional": true, "os": [ @@ -3030,9 +3018,6 @@ "loong64" ], "dev": true, - "libc": [ - "glibc" - ], "license": "MIT", "optional": true, "os": [ @@ -3047,9 +3032,6 @@ "loong64" ], "dev": true, - "libc": [ - "musl" - ], "license": "MIT", "optional": true, "os": [ @@ -3064,9 +3046,6 @@ "ppc64" ], "dev": true, - "libc": [ - "glibc" - ], "license": "MIT", "optional": true, "os": [ @@ -3081,9 +3060,6 @@ "ppc64" ], "dev": true, - "libc": [ - "musl" - ], "license": "MIT", "optional": true, "os": [ @@ -3098,9 +3074,6 @@ "riscv64" ], "dev": true, - "libc": [ - "glibc" - ], "license": "MIT", "optional": true, "os": [ @@ -3115,9 +3088,6 @@ "riscv64" ], "dev": true, - "libc": [ - "musl" - ], "license": "MIT", "optional": true, "os": [ @@ -3132,9 +3102,6 @@ "s390x" ], "dev": true, - "libc": [ - "glibc" - ], "license": "MIT", "optional": true, "os": [ @@ -3149,9 +3116,6 @@ "x64" ], "dev": true, - "libc": [ - "glibc" - ], "license": "MIT", "optional": true, "os": [ @@ -3166,9 +3130,6 @@ "x64" ], "dev": true, - "libc": [ - "musl" - ], "license": "MIT", "optional": true, "os": [ diff --git a/iron-and-vines-main/vite.config.ts b/iron-and-vines-main/vite.config.ts index 00b997e..11ac2fa 100644 --- a/iron-and-vines-main/vite.config.ts +++ b/iron-and-vines-main/vite.config.ts @@ -6,8 +6,8 @@ import { componentTagger } from "lovable-tagger"; // https://vitejs.dev/config/ export default defineConfig(({ mode }) => ({ server: { - host: "::", - port: 8080, + host: "0.0.0.0", allowedHosts: [".dev.flatlogic.app", "localhost", "127.0.0.1"], + port: 3001, hmr: { overlay: false, },